The role:

Key Stage 2 teacher requires patience, creativity, and a passion for nurturing young minds. It can be a rewarding role, shaping the educational experiences of children during a crucial stage of their development.

responsible for planning and delivering engaging and well-structured lessons across different subjects.
Provide teaching in core subjects such as English, Mathematics, and Science, as well as other subjects like History, Geography, Art, Music, PE, and Design and Technology.
Ensure that students have a solid foundation in these subjects, imparting knowledge, skills, and understanding.
Creating a positive and productive classroom environment is essential.
promote a respectful and inclusive atmosphere where students feel safe to learn and participate.
Track students' progress over time and identify areas where additional support is needed.
Regularly assess students' progress through a range of methods, including tests, projects, classwork, and observations. They provide timely feedback to students, helping them understand their strengths and areas for improvement.
